Beatrice Destin passed away on Friday, July 16, 2016, at age 88. Born in San Francisco, CA she was preceded in death by her parents, Rose and Jacob "Jack" Isaac Sobol, and her loving husband Victor Nicholas Destin. Her brother Arthur Bernard Sobol was a casualty of WWII in 1945.

Bea grew up in the Richmond District and graduated George Washington H.S. in 1945 and then earned a BA in Decorative Arts from UC Berkeley in 1949. While at Cal she worked at Livingston Brothers Department Store in San Francisco. After graduating, she worked as an executive secretary for US Steel and then later for the market research firm Dataquest.

In 1955 she met Victor at a Cal / Stanford football game party. The two married a year later and settled in their native San Francisco. They remained married for nearly 58 years. They enjoyed playing tennis, world travel, and attending symphony concerts and operas.

Bea was dearly loved and is survived by her son Arthur and his wife Maureen and their children Sarah, Michael, and Andrew (all of Saratoga); son Richard and his wife Esther Margulies and their children Josiah and Lilia (all of Venice, CA); and daughter Victoria and her husband Daniel Goldberg, and their children Ben and Caroline (all of Pacific Palisades, CA).

The family would like to thank her devoted caregivers at Atria Park of Pacific Palisades and at Familiar Surroundings Home Care of San Jose.

Bea is going to be interred at Madronia Cemetery in Saratoga after a private family service. In lieu of flowers donations may be sent to the Symphony Silicon Valley.
